Author: Melissa Noel Renzi

Melissa Renzi, MSW, LSW, CYT-200 is a social worker and yoga teacher who helps highly sensitive people transform anxiety and engage their sensitive strengths as empowered agents of inner and outer healing. She leads global retreats designed specifically for highly sensitive people and introverts that focus on renewing self-care and deepening their connection to nature and other cultures.
